E-billingSwitch to e-billing, simplify your life.
Hera is launching an important campaign with a dual environmental advantage: by choosing to receive
your bills by e-mail you will reduce paper consumption and contribute to the creation of new urban green
areas.
For each 50 subscriptions, Hera will plant a tree in the city.Goals

Environmental advantages
The project combines two actions that contribute to protecting the environment.
On one hand the process of dematerialisation generated by the electronic bill prevents the consumption of large
quantities of paper, reduces waste and eliminates emissions associated with mailing. On the other hand, the planting of
trees increases the territory’s ability to absorb CO2.
Hera decided to contribute by planting trees in the cities to enhance the environmental benefits resulting from
dematerialisation. In fact, green areas in the city play an important role in improving the urban environment.

Over its entire life cycle (50 years) a tree can absorb up to 3
t of CO2.
In addition to the absorption of CO2, the trees also contribute
substantially to the absorption of pollutants in the air such as
pm10.The plantings in the area
promote the creation of wooded areas in the city that can be
enjoyed and accessed by citizens, improving air quality
and the urban environment

The new green areas can be created, upon
the achievement of the objectives, in all the
municipalities participating in the
initiative. All 185 municipalities served are involved in the initiative and today the 23 largest cities (>
20,000 inhabitants) have already joined, identifying the areas
where the approximately 1,500 trees will be planted.
We are currently working towards involving smaller
municipalities (< 20,000 inhabitants) in the
project.
